YouTube: VideoHandles Jarrod Knibbe, Sue Ann Seah and Mike Fraser presented their work on VideoHandles at SUI 2014 and received an honorable mention for best short paper. VideoHandles is a novel interaction technique for searching through action-camera (e.g. GoPro) video collections.
